Lincolnshire Residents Warned Not to Stockpile Vapes

  • UK vapers are urgently stockpiling disposable vape devices ahead of a planned ban set for June 1, 2025.
  • This surge follows growing concern that ending disposables will remove convenience, flavour variety, and simplicity, according to Vape Superstore research.
  • A survey of 510 vapers found 70% plan to stockpile disposables, a sharp rise from 25% in November 2024, while 53% consider reusable alternatives despite 61% finding them complex.
  • Safety experts warn that hoarding lithium-ion vape devices risks thermal runaway, which can cause explosions and toxic gas release, urging caution before bulk buying.
  • The ban may cause unintended consequences without clear consumer guidance, highlighting the need for education on safer transitions and informed vaping choices.
